> With regards to any problems in tilde.c, I'd prefer to resolve this by
> deleting the file. I don't think the Info browser needs to convert
> tilde characters into the user's home directory. I don't know why this
> feature was added in the first place (looking at the ChangeLog, it
> looks like it's been there from the start).

Most probably this feature is there to emulate Emacs.

> Tilde expansion is done by the shell so there's no need for Info to
> do it as well.

??? When I type "C-x C-f" in Info, no shell will help me expand the
tilde in the file name I type after that.  Likewise if I want to
specify a file name in the argument given to the 'g' command.
